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Oklahoma City Apartments

What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Oklahoma City?

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Oklahoma City is at Spring Creek Apartments listed at $450.

How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Oklahoma City Apartment?

The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Oklahoma City is $1,297.

What is the largest Pet Friendly Oklahoma City Apartment for rent?

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Oklahoma City is a 3,489 square feet unit starting from $1,670 at The First Residences at First National.

What is the average size for Oklahoma City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Oklahoma City is currently at 708 sq ft.
